Email Content Strategy to Maintain Subscriber Engagement
This prompt guides you to create an email content strategy tailored to maintaining subscriber engagement. It instructs you to analyze the provided subscriber profile and objectives to generate a detailed plan outlining the types of content to include in emails. The output includes specific content categories, frequency recommendations, and engagement tactics. Use this template by supplying your subscriber demographics and engagement goals to receive a structured email content framework.
Act as a professional email marketing strategist with expertise in subscriber engagement. Based on the provided [SUBSCRIBER PROFILE], placeholder and [ENGAGEMENT OBJECTIVES], placeholder, create a comprehensive email content strategy that specifies the types of content to include in emails to keep subscribers interested. Include recommended content categories, optimal sending frequency, and engagement techniques tailored to the audience. Present the output as a structured content framework that guides email creation from planning to execution.
Highlighted text is a blank. Swap it for your own detail before you send the prompt.
What it produces
- Content categories: educational articles, product updates, customer stories, exclusive offers
- Sending frequency: weekly newsletters with bi-weekly promotional emails
- Engagement techniques: personalized subject lines, interactive polls, clear call-to-actions
